Score 94/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, May 2011

Bright, deep ruby. Pungent, high-pitched aromas of cassis, violet and crushed rock; hints at a distinct mineral austerity. Then almost surprisingly lush and sweet on the palate, with rich, clean dark berry flavors expanding to fill the mouth and building on the finish. This highly concentrated, multilayered wine finishes with noble tannins and terrific lingering violet perfume.

Score 96/100 · Drink 2013-2043, Robert Parker, Dec 2010

Another stunning effort, the 2008 Cabernet Sauvignon Howell Mountain comes from Jess Jackson's well-known Keyes Vineyard high on Howell Mountain. Like all of these wines, it is 100% Cabernet Sauvignon. It offers stunning notes of crushed rocks, boysenberries, blueberries, black raspberries, black currants, graphite and a hint of toasty oak as well as a sensationally concentrated mid-palate and finish. Forget it for 3-5 years and drink it over the following three decades. One of the stars in Jess Jackson's Artisans and Estates portfolio, Lokoya focuses on high elevation mountain vineyards in four separate Napa appellations. Winemaker Chris Carpenter has been the force behind these wines for many years. Production levels were very low in 2008 with the exception of the Mt. Veeder (approximately 700 cases). The magnificent 2007 remains the vintage of reference for Lokoya along with 1997, 2001 and 2002. However, 2008 is a strong vintage although the spring frosts dramatically curtailed quantity. Speaking of the 2007s, which I reviewed from bottle last year, the scores they merited were: 2007 Diamond Mountain (95), 2007 Howell Mountain (97), 2007 Mt.
